I decided I'd better update all the ThinkPad drivers and such, since
it's been a while. My old IBM Update Connector never worked right,
and it looks like it's no longer supported. So I downloaded and
installed ThinkVantage System Update, which seems to be the
replacement.
When I start running it, it pops up a window "User Information" which
identifies my machine (logical enough). However it says:
Machine type and model: TP-1R___
Operating system: Windows XP
Language: EN
It really does have underscores in the machine type, I'm guessing at
three. In fact I have a TP41p 2373-GEU.
Assuming the above information might actually be correct, I let it
continue, and when it gets to 16% complete (during "Downloading
package information: Lenovo Help Center (1 of 1)") I get an error:
Searching For Updates
Error 75 received from the Package Index Server. Please contact the
Support Center.
I couldn't find this error message by googling (did find an Error 76
question posted on the ThinkPads forum but no answer that seemed
relevant to my problem.
